Summary

CVE-2023-46376 is a vulnerability affecting Zentao Biz version 8.7 and earlier. The vulnerability allows for Information Disclosure, posing a high risk to organizations. The affected products are 't0TPrv' and 't0TPru'. To remediate the vulnerability, it is recommended to update to a version beyond 8.7 or apply any relevant patches provided by the vendor. The vulnerability has a CVSSv3 base score of 7.5 (high severity) with no privileges required, no user interaction, and an attack vector through the network. It impacts confidentiality with no integrity or availability impact identified.
